Mario y Mauricio Lira with 18 years of experience in the construction of hotels had decided to venture in a new concept of vacation rentals featuring 5-star hotel amenities.

In an exclusive interview with Inmobiliare, they stated that they came up with a hybrid concept based on their work with hotel corporations and their own experiencies as guests. The concept combines vacation rental and 5-star accommodations.

“We began to detect that people were no longer interested in the typical all-inclusive resort, so we began to feel that a change was needed. Airbnb began to open a very important niche, with the fact that people feel better believing that they are at home; and that during your stay in that place you can “feel at home”, but this time, without leaving aside the hotel services, since we all like to be pampered. Hence the idea of this hybrid which is not only a nice apartment with hotel services, but a unique “homelike” experience for each traveler.

On June 15 is the opening of its first development, Auténtico Vertical Zona Real, which is located within Jardines del Valle in Zapopan, Guadalajara, Jalisco and has an extension of 4,500 m2 of construction distributed in two towers of 9 floors connected by an upper bridge which serves as roof garden and events area.

With an investment of 90 million pesos, it has 30 apartments with kitchen, living room and bathrooms; in total, there are 50 bedrooms, distributed in 2 penthouses, 16 accommodations with double rooms and 12 with just one bedroom, “they are not a reduced hotel room where you have limited space,” they reiterated. Each apartment integrates a modern architectural concept that celebrates its authentic style in each of the venues, and interior decoration includes paintings by the artist Emmanuel Mendoza.

This first development features state-of-the-art technology, surveillance cameras, in addition to Tesla chargers, a brand with which the developers maintain an alliance, like Ferrari and Nespresso.

The next projects under development are located in Los Cabos, Tulum and Punta Cana in the Dominican Republic and in the next few years they expect to expand to other countries.

“We are constantly in search of new destinations, always with an attractiveness that goes according to our concept; we try to settle our projects in places with their own essence with a soul. We like to try to be pioneers in all these aspects “.
